Drive from Dehradun to Sankri
Distance: Approximately 198-220 kilometers
Travel Time: 8-10 hours by road
Morning:
Depart from Dehradun early in the morning (around 6:00 AM) via bus or private vehicle. Direct buses to Sankri are available from the bus station near the railway station, typically departing between 7 AM and 8 AM.
Route:
The journey will take you through scenic routes, passing through Mussoorie, Mori, and Naitwar. Enjoy views of the Yamuna and Tons rivers along the way.
Afternoon:
Arrive in Sankri by late afternoon. This quaint village serves as the base for your trek. Check into your accommodation—options range from guesthouses to homestays.
Evening:
Explore Sankri, enjoy a local meal, and acclimatize to the altitude (6,400 feet). Take a leisurely stroll around the village and prepare for the trek ahead.

Overview
The Kedarkantha trek is a popular winter trek in Uttarakhand, India, known for its stunning views and serene landscapes. The journey begins in Dehradun and takes you through picturesque villages and dense forests to the summit of Kedarkantha Peak.

Tour Itinerary
Distance: 5 kilometers
Trek Duration: Approximately 4-5 hours
Morning:
After breakfast, start your trek towards Juda Ka Talab, a beautiful alpine lake surrounded by pine forests.
Route:
The trail ascends gradually through dense forests filled with oak and pine trees. You will cross several streams and enjoy breathtaking views of the surrounding mountains.
Afternoon:
Arrive at Juda Ka Talab by noon. Set up camp near the lake, which is a great spot for photography and relaxation.
Evening:
Enjoy dinner at the campsite and spend the night under the stars.
Distance: Approximately 3 kilometers
Trek Duration: About 2.5-3 hours
Morning:
After breakfast, continue your ascent towards Kedarkantha Base Camp.
Route:
The trail involves a moderate climb with stunning views of snow-capped peaks. The base camp is at an altitude of around 10,500 feet.
Afternoon:
Arrive at the base camp by midday. Settle in, rest, and acclimatize to the higher altitude.
Evening:
Enjoy dinner at camp and prepare for an early start the next day for the summit ascent.
Distance: Approximately 6 kilometers round trip
Trek Duration: About 7 hours total (up and down)
Early Morning:
Start your ascent to Kedarkantha Peak around 4 AM to catch the sunrise from the summit.
Route:
The trek involves steep climbs but rewards you with panoramic views of major peaks like Swargarohini and Bandarpoonch from the top (12,500 feet).
Mid-Morning:
Spend some time at the summit enjoying the breathtaking views before beginning your descent back to Kedarkantha Base Camp.
Afternoon:
Return to base camp for lunch and rest before packing up for your journey back down.
Distance: Approximately 9 kilometers
Trek Duration: About 6 hours
Morning:
After breakfast, begin your descent back towards Sankri via Hargaon campsite.
Route:
The trail will take you through beautiful meadows and forests, offering a different perspective of the landscape compared to your ascent.
Afternoon:
Arrive back in Sankri by early afternoon. Check into your accommodation and relax after the trek.
Distance: Approximately 198 kilometers
Travel Time: About 8 hours
Morning:
After breakfast in Sankri, prepare for your return journey to Dehradun.
Route:
Retrace your steps back through the scenic roads of Uttarakhand.
Afternoon/Evening:
Arrive back in Dehradun by evening. This marks the end of your Kedarkantha trek adventure.
